Cargando…
Intelligent Path-Selection-Aided Decoding of Polar Codes
CRC-aided successive cancellation list (CA-SCL) decoding is a powerful algorithm that dramatically improves the error performance of polar codes. Path selection is a major issue that affects the decoding latency of SCL decoders. Generally, path selection is implemented using a metric sorter, which c...
Autores principales: | , , |
---|---|
Formato: | Online Artículo Texto |
Lenguaje: | English |
Publicado: |
MDPI
2023
|
Materias: | |
Acceso en línea: | https://www.ncbi.nlm.nih.gov/pmc/articles/PMC9955424/ https://www.ncbi.nlm.nih.gov/pubmed/36832567 http://dx.doi.org/10.3390/e25020200 |
_version_ | 1784894341895946240 |
---|---|
author | Cui, Hongji Niu, Kai Zhong, Shunfu |
author_facet | Cui, Hongji Niu, Kai Zhong, Shunfu |
author_sort | Cui, Hongji |
collection | PubMed |
description | CRC-aided successive cancellation list (CA-SCL) decoding is a powerful algorithm that dramatically improves the error performance of polar codes. Path selection is a major issue that affects the decoding latency of SCL decoders. Generally, path selection is implemented using a metric sorter, which causes its latency to increase as the list grows. In this paper, intelligent path selection (IPS) is proposed as an alternative to the traditional metric sorter. First, we found that in the path selection, only the most reliable paths need to be selected, and it is not necessary to completely sort all paths. Second, based on a neural network model, an intelligent path selection scheme is proposed, including a fully connected network construction, a threshold and a post-processing unit. Simulation results show that the proposed path-selection method can achieve comparable performance gain to the existing methods under SCL/CA-SCL decoding. Compared with the conventional methods, IPS has lower latency for medium and large list sizes. For the proposed hardware structure, IPS’s time complexity is [Formula: see text] where k is the number of hidden layers of the network and L is the list size. |
format | Online Article Text |
id | pubmed-9955424 |
institution | National Center for Biotechnology Information |
language | English |
publishDate | 2023 |
publisher | MDPI |
record_format | MEDLINE/PubMed |
spelling | pubmed-99554242023-02-25 Intelligent Path-Selection-Aided Decoding of Polar Codes Cui, Hongji Niu, Kai Zhong, Shunfu Entropy (Basel) Article CRC-aided successive cancellation list (CA-SCL) decoding is a powerful algorithm that dramatically improves the error performance of polar codes. Path selection is a major issue that affects the decoding latency of SCL decoders. Generally, path selection is implemented using a metric sorter, which causes its latency to increase as the list grows. In this paper, intelligent path selection (IPS) is proposed as an alternative to the traditional metric sorter. First, we found that in the path selection, only the most reliable paths need to be selected, and it is not necessary to completely sort all paths. Second, based on a neural network model, an intelligent path selection scheme is proposed, including a fully connected network construction, a threshold and a post-processing unit. Simulation results show that the proposed path-selection method can achieve comparable performance gain to the existing methods under SCL/CA-SCL decoding. Compared with the conventional methods, IPS has lower latency for medium and large list sizes. For the proposed hardware structure, IPS’s time complexity is [Formula: see text] where k is the number of hidden layers of the network and L is the list size. MDPI 2023-01-19 /pmc/articles/PMC9955424/ /pubmed/36832567 http://dx.doi.org/10.3390/e25020200 Text en © 2023 by the authors. https://creativecommons.org/licenses/by/4.0/Licensee MDPI, Basel, Switzerland. This article is an open access article distributed under the terms and conditions of the Creative Commons Attribution (CC BY) license (https://creativecommons.org/licenses/by/4.0/). |
spellingShingle | Article Cui, Hongji Niu, Kai Zhong, Shunfu Intelligent Path-Selection-Aided Decoding of Polar Codes |
title | Intelligent Path-Selection-Aided Decoding of Polar Codes |
title_full | Intelligent Path-Selection-Aided Decoding of Polar Codes |
title_fullStr | Intelligent Path-Selection-Aided Decoding of Polar Codes |
title_full_unstemmed | Intelligent Path-Selection-Aided Decoding of Polar Codes |
title_short | Intelligent Path-Selection-Aided Decoding of Polar Codes |
title_sort | intelligent path-selection-aided decoding of polar codes |
topic | Article |
url | https://www.ncbi.nlm.nih.gov/pmc/articles/PMC9955424/ https://www.ncbi.nlm.nih.gov/pubmed/36832567 http://dx.doi.org/10.3390/e25020200 |
work_keys_str_mv | AT cuihongji intelligentpathselectionaideddecodingofpolarcodes AT niukai intelligentpathselectionaideddecodingofpolarcodes AT zhongshunfu intelligentpathselectionaideddecodingofpolarcodes |